I have puppet running on WEBrick.
Dashboard works. I can see the hosts currently in puppet.
In Dashboard I can add hosts and create groups, but cannot add classes. The auto-search returns nothing when I click on a group or server and start typing in the Classes textbox.

Is this a common occurrence with Dashboard?
I have looked on the web and found no answer.

Appreciate any pointers.

Thanks.

I figured this out.

On the dashboard:
- Click Add classs
- type in exactly the class name as it exist in the puppet modules directory and click create
- Edit a node or group and the auto search will find the class (a.k.a. module)
